*Studying response to anesthesia options for elective procedures
We are enrolling any healthy horse undergoing general anesthesia for elective surgery to compare the effects of oral trazodone as part of the anesthetic protocol. This study will help understand the effect of oral trazodone and make general anesthesia safer for horses in the future. There are 3 different treatment groups, including a placebo group. Your horse will be randomly assigned to one group.
Your participation is voluntary and there is no cost to enroll. You will receive a $100 credit off your bill and up to 2 additional nights of stall boarding in the hospital, if needed.
